Output 95502daf7623f66f2031020db5f9ba80d871fab96e553fe1eb2e0d02e6020149:1

value
3332320
script pubkey
OP_0 OP_PUSHBYTES_20 1ded2572d55fdcb7a95dfe93094cdf1e6ff72606
address
ltc1qrhkj2uk4tlwt022al6fsjnxlrehlwfsxjw477s
transaction
95502daf7623f66f2031020db5f9ba80d871fab96e553fe1eb2e0d02e6020149
spent
true